Comprehending Designated Agents
A designated agent is a appointed individual or business responsible for handling lawful documents, government communications, and formal notices on behalf of a business. This role is crucial for maintaining that a business continues compliant with local laws and regulations. Each jurisdiction requires organizations, including incorporated businesses and Limited Liability Companies, to have a registered agent who is accessible during operating hours to handle essential paperwork.
The responsibilities of a registered agent include forwarding legal documents, such as legal summons, tax notifications, and annual report requests, to the appropriate individuals within the business. By having a designated agent, organizations can maintain confidentiality, as the agent's location is listed in public records instead of the company's address. This can help guard against unsolicited solicitations and provide a layer of confidentiality for company owners.

Cost of Registered Agent Fees
The price of agent services can differ significantly based on multiple considerations, including the type of service, the degree of help provided, and the regional area of your company. Generally, organizations can expect pay anywhere from $50 to $300 dollars per annum for a registered agent service. While there are various alternatives available, it's crucial to compare cost and services to find the optimal choice for your needs.

Adherence and Regulatory Requirements
Understanding adherence and regulatory obligations is essential for any enterprise entity, regardless of whether it is an LLC or a corporate entity. Every state mandates that businesses designate a designated agent who is responsible for handling important legal documents, such as service of legal action, financial notices, and state regulatory communications. Neglect to appoint a registered agent can lead to serious repercussions, including penalties and the risk for default judgments against the business. Therefore, confirming that your designated agent meets these regulatory obligations is vital for upholding good status with state authorities.
The regulatory obligations surrounding registered agents can differ by state, but there are common elements that many jurisdictions have in common. Generally, a designated agent must be a resident of the state where the company is incorporated or a corporate entity licensed to operate business in that state. Moreover, the registered agent must have a real address in the state; a P.O. box is not. These requirements emphasize the importance of selecting a reliable and compliant registered agent provider that meets every legal obligations, thereby protecting the company from unnecessary legal risks.
Registered agents also have specific duties beyond simply receiving documents. They must ensure timely delivery of every documents to the business owner and maintain accurate records of every communications. Moreover, registered agents play a critical role in ensuring adherence with state regulations by notifying businesses of any deadlines and requirements they need to meet. This proactive approach helps businesses avoid interruptions in adherence that could threaten their business practices and reputation in the industry.
